Analogy for Competitive and Non- Competitive Enzyme Inhibition Rate Graph
Situation: Preschool birthday party game of musical chairs. The preschoolers are the substrate, the chairs are the enzymes, dads are competitive inhibitors and siblings are non-competitive inhibitors.
Competitive Inhibition
Some of the parent’s want to play. But the more parents there are the less likely the preschoolers are going to get a seat when the music stops. Eventually there will be a point when they are out competed for the seats because there are so many parents playing
Non Competitive Inhibition
The preschoolers have older siblings who are too cool to be at a party like this. When the music starts they run around pushing the chairs over so they can’t be used in the game anymore. It doesn’t matter how many preschoolers there are, they can’t ever fill all of the chairs because some are out of action.

Ask the first question to the class. The pupil who gets the question right, gets to choose a square to remove.
This continues until either the questions are completed or the catchphrase is guessed.
The winner is the person who can guess the biological catchphrase from the picture

This is a Brainstorm detailing the key points of the AQA Biology 8461 syllabus. I have used it as part of a group brainstorming activity, as follows:
Group pupils into teams with 4/5 members and ask them to work together to create a brainstorm on metabolism. To support them give them a copy of the ‘cue sheet’.
To ensure that all members have a role to play and take responsibility for it, also give the groups a ‘group task sheet’. They have to sign their name against the role that they are going to take responsibility for. This ensures that everyone is taking part.
Give them a set time to work on the task and then swap the brainstorms between groups and ask them to peer assess them eg write targets for improvement on post-it notes.
Give them a set period of time to meet the targets.
Then give them a printed copy of the already completed metabolism brainstorm. Ask them to make additions to their own and to highlight anything that they have got which is not on the prepared brainstorm

Biologists use microscopes to see things that they can't see clearly with the naked eye. Microscopes are a fairly expensive piece of equipment and generally not very portable. In this practical you will convert smart phone/tablet to create a simple, portable digital microscope using cheap, easily accessible components. Then use it to explore and make observations about the microscopic details of everyday things.
